Transform your leftover sweet bread into a delightful dessert with this Sweet Bread Bread Pudding recipe—a timeless comfort food with a rich, custardy base and a golden, slightly crisp topping. Made with day-old brioche or challah, the bread soaks up a luscious mixture of milk, cream, eggs, and warm spices like cinnamon and nutmeg, creating a dessert that's irresistibly moist and flavorful. A touch of brown sugar adds caramel-like depth, while optional raisins add bursts of sweetness with every bite. 🥘 Ingredients

12 items
  • 8 cups (cubed) sweet bread (e.g., brioche or challah, preferably day-old)
  • 2 cups whole milk
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 0.75 cup granulated sugar
  • 0.25 cup brown sugar
  • 1 tablespoon vanilla extract
  • 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• 0.25 teaspoon ground nutmeg
  • 4 large eggs
  • 0.5 cup raisins (optional)
  • 1 tablespoon butter (for greasing the baking dish)
  • 1 tablespoon powdered sugar (optional, for dusting)

📝 Instructions

8 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ease a 9x13-inch baking dish with butter.

2

Cut the sweet bread into 1-inch cubes and spread them evenly in the prepared baking dish. If using raisins, sprinkle them over the bread cubes.

3

In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the milk, heavy cream, granulated sugar, brown sugar, vanilla extract, cinnamon, nutmeg, and eggs until fully combined.

4

Slowly pour the custard mixture over the bread cubes, ensuring all pieces are soaked. Press lightly with a spatula to help the bread absorb the liquid.

5

Allow the mixture to sit for 10 minutes so the bread fully absorbs the custard.

6

Place the baking dish in the oven and bake for 40-45 minutes, or until the top is golden brown and the custard is set. A knife inserted in the center should come out clean.

7

Remove the bread pudding from the oven and let it cool for at least 10 minutes before serving.

8

Dust with powdered sugar if desired and serve warm. Optionally, pair with whipped cream, ice cream, or a drizzle of caramel sauce.
